Plane crash lands near Mehsana airport; Trainee girl pilot on solo flight safe and out of danger

Mehsana: A two-seater Cessna 152 aircraft had a crash landing near Mehsana airport today. The female trainee pilot, who was on a solo flight, suffered minor injuries. However, she is safe, stable, and out of any danger. She is walking and mobile.

The incident occurred around 7 pm, with fire brigade sources stating that the trainee pilot, Alekhya Pechetti, sustained minor injuries. “She was first taken to a government hospital and later transferred to a private hospital for further treatment,” officials of Mehsana municipality fire department reported.

After flying for about an hour, Pechetti suspected a technical issue with the aircraft and notified the aviation institute. A team was sent to assist, but the aircraft made a hard landing in a field, causing damage.

According to BlueRay Aviation, the company’s team is with the pilot to render any support she may need, both medically and otherwise. Rohit Chivukua of Blue Ray Aviation Private Limited stated, “We are grateful that she is safe and well.”

The Mehsana Taluka police, along with the fire brigade, arrived at the scene. The cause of the crash is currently under investigation. DeshGujarat
